Overview

The ACCelerators are student-centric innovative learning and student engagement environments that provide holistic learning support and technology resources to accelerate students’ preparation for academic and life success, based upon their unique needs and goals. They are located at the Highland, Rio Grande, Round Rock, and San Gabriel campuses. They provide access to 1,000+ computer stations, study rooms, open study areas, and other technological resources. The ACCelerator core functions are open technology access, innovative teaching/instruction, academic support services, student support services, and community engagement.

Accomplishments

student sitting at ACCelerator computer
ACCelerators promote innovative learning and support through computers, study rooms, tutors, academic coaching and advising, scholarship assistance, and registration support.

In fall 2022, the ACCelerators hit a milestone by surpassing one million unique student visits by 120,000+ student visitors. During the 2022-23 academic year, 34% of the total ACC student population visited an ACCelerator, with over 15,000 unique student visitors and over 107,000 visits. Students accessed computers, study rooms, tutors, academic coaching, scholarship assistance, registration support, and academic advising.

Student support specialists in the ACCelerators contacted over 17,000 students during outreach “call-a-thons” campaigns to support dual credit enrollment, unregistered/deregistered re-enrollment, and scholarship assistance.

The ACCelerators offered over 30+ courses such as English, math, Japanese, geography, fashion, psychology and general education classes. This year faculty and instructors were able to utilize the ACCelerators’ Distance Learning Synchronous areas (DLS hubs) which supported teaching formats such as HyFlex, hybrid, and online only.

Impact

The ACCelerators strongly impact student engagement by being a welcoming and collaborative space where students feel a sense of belonging to the college because it is the location where they get the support they need by feeling welcomed, recognized as individuals, and made to feel they matter to the institution. The ACCelerators are the most visited area across the college, with 100,000+ visits this current academic year, where they are able to take classes, have access to technology, have easy access to support, and where customer service is of utmost importance to the overall student experience. In a recent survey 97% of ACCelerator visitors said they were satisfied or extremely satisfied with their experience.
